Alireza Firouzja Wins Grand Chess Tour in Sinquefield Cup

Alireza Firouzja secured victory in the Grand Chess Tour, winning the Sinquefield Cup with a round to spare. The eighth round saw a flurry of draws, with Indian Grandmasters D Gukesh and R Praggnanandhaa both ending their games in draws. Despite the draws, Firouzja’s consistent performance throughout the tournament earned him a USD 100,000 bonus.

Firouzja Leads Saint Louis Rapid and Blitz Tournament After Strong Blitz Performance

Alireza Firouzja extended his lead in the Saint Louis Rapid and Blitz chess tournament after a dominant performance in the first day of the blitz section. The French grandmaster now sits on 17.5 points, 1.5 points ahead of Wesley So, who had a stellar blitz performance with seven wins out of nine. Meanwhile, R. Praggnanandhaa remained in last place despite a couple of wins, including victories against Ian Nepomniachtchi and Hikaru Nakamura.

Caruana Defends Superbet Classic Title in Thrilling Tiebreaker

Fabiano Caruana emerged victorious in a dramatic tiebreaker at the Superbet Classic, defeating fellow contenders Gukesh, Praggnanandhaa, and Alireza Firouzja to claim the title and a $68,500 prize. The tournament saw Caruana lose in the classical format, opening the door for a thrilling four-way tiebreaker after a relatively uneventful classical section.
